Introduction

Title images can do a lot to give your game a decent first impression.
However, when they're the same thing seen over and over during multiple
loads, playthroughs, etc., they can get old pretty fast. This plugin gives
you, the game developer, the ability to change the title screen image(s) to
whatever you want during any point of the game you want, so that the next
time your players return to the title screen, they'll be treated with
something new and refreshing!

Instructions

Choosing what title screen image will appear is quite simple. By default,
the image that will be shown will be the ones applied in the settings.
But if you want to control it when the player has reached a certain point in
your game, put in these plugin commands in an event to determine what images
will be shown the next time your player views the title screen:

Plugin Commands:

ChangeTitle1 filename
ChangeTitle2 filename
- Replace 'filename' with the image's filename found in your 'titles1' or
'titles2' folders respectively. Make sure the filename is exactly as it
appears as it is case sensitive. Once an event runs this plugin command, the
next time the player visits the title screen, the new image(s) will appear.

ClearChangeTitle1
ClearChangeTitle2
- This will revert the Title1 or Title2 images back to default respectively.
The player will see the default Title1/Title2 image that's been applied in
the game's database settings.
